Tom Hardwick

BA(Hons) MArch PGDip.Arch ARB RIBA

Chartered Architect and Founding Director

Tom is an RIBA Chartered Architect, registered with the Architects Registration Board (ARB), and founding director of Hardwick Studio Architects Ltd, alongside Jemma.

He achieved RIBA Parts 1, 2 and 3 by working his way through the Undergraduate, Masters and Post-Graduate degree courses at the University of Lincoln, where he was an award-winning student – being awarded the RIBA Part 2 Masters Award.

Tom utilised his experiences at a range of architectural practices to amass a wealth of knowledge across all stages of project development, leading to a strong foundation for the formation of architectural design practice, Hardwick Studio Architects – a theory-lead innovative and creative studio focused on being explorative in our approach in establishing the best solution. Tom is responsible for developing the vision of the practice and leading the design of projects, working closely with clients throughout their journeys.

The experiences Tom has through previous employment and at Hardwick Studio Architects Ltd, include extensive involvement in the residential, domestic commercial and agricultural sectors, successfully delivering schemes ranging from luxury bespoke new build house and barn conversions through to larger master planning and multi-home design schemes, mixed-use development schemes, agricultural diversification and commercial schemes.

Tom believes in developing architecture that elevates the end-user experience, creating timeless design solutions appropriate to the social and economic context in which they are set. He is a committed and intelligent strategic thinker who understands clients’ requirements, with an ability to find clear and elegant solutions to resolve complex problems.

Tom also maintains a key interest in architectural theory and how this can be utilised within practice, whilst challenging and pushing the boundaries of design, establishing a strong team to develop the most appropriate solution for any design brief.

Shella Aziz

BA(Hons) MArch

Architectural Consultant

Shella brings a wealth of knowledge and experience to her role as Architectural Consultant at Hardwick Studio Architects Ltd. She holds a BA (Hons) in Architecture (RIBA Part 1) from the University of Westminster and a Master’s in Architecture (RIBA Part 2) from Birmingham University.

With a career that includes time at internationally renowned practices such as Foster + Partners and Grimshaw, Shella has developed a deep understanding of design excellence, construction techniques, and regulatory compliance. Her meticulous attention to detail and broad technical expertise make her an invaluable asset to every stage of the design and delivery process.

Shella has a particular passion for sustainable architecture. She has undertaken accredited training in Passivhaus and Enerphit standards, and she applies this knowledge to create environmentally responsible and energy-efficient designs. Her Passivhaus design knowledge is very impressive and focus’ on achieving exceptional energy efficiency and occupant comfort through a holistic, integrated approach to building design. This knowledge allows for the creation of Shella buildings that consume significantly less energy for heating and cooling compared to conventional buildings, leading to substantial cost savings and reduced environmental impact.
